Practical Considerations for Using Pro Create

Before incorporating Pro Create into your design projects, it's important to consider a few practical aspects. First, check the included styles, alternates, and ligatures to see how they can enhance your designs. Additionally, ensure that the font supports the languages you need, as multilingual support is crucial for reaching a broader audience. Finally, verify the commercial font licensing to ensure you can use Pro Create in your ebooks, templates, printables, and other commercial projects.

Font Pairing with Pro Create

To create a balanced and harmonious design, consider pairing Pro Create with a readable serif or sans serif font for body copy. This combination allows the handwritten style of Pro Create to shine in headings and decorative elements while maintaining readability in longer text. For example, I paired Pro Create with a clean sans serif font for the body text in my ebook, resulting in a visually appealing and easy-to-read layout.
